At the risk of being indiscreet, could someone let us learners in on the joke?

Since no one translated it above, I was guessing it was "Shut yer hole!" But I've read now that "Fá dtaobh de" is the Donegal way of saying "about". So is the joke that saying "faduda" all the time is a key Donegal trait, so that's Tadhg's nickname for a Donegalman's mouth?

(I'm catching up with RnR and just saw the episode now. Nine episodes in, Tadhg's the best character so far.)


Yep...that's the joke. Well, actually, the joke was that the subtitles said "shut your mouth," but what Tadhg actually said was "dún do 'Fá dtaobh de". The more Irish you understand, the more of what's actually said, vs. what the subtitles say, you catch, which is part of the fun.

One of the easier ones to catch is when the subtitles say a character said "Oh my God." It's usually actually something like "a mhaighdean!" or "Dia sábháil!"
